In the high season of 2023, Azores Airlines won the hearts of travelers, being the main choice in terms of airlines for those embarking on the archipelago. The positive results were revealed in the Azores Tourist Satisfaction Report for the season, recently published by the Azores Tourism Observatory.

With 64.57% of passengers expressing great satisfaction regarding the destination and the quality/price of air transport in the Azores, Azores Airlines was highlighted as the favorite.

Teresa Gonçalves, President of Grupo SATA, expressed her satisfaction, “It is with great satisfaction that we witness Azores Airlines standing out as the most sought after airline when planning a trip to the Azores. We are very honored with this distinction, which reflects the hard work and dedication we have been putting in to meet the expectations of those who choose to explore our Archipelago. SATA Group airlines are the reference when it comes to travel to the Azores and within the Archipelago, confirming, this survey, that passengers are satisfied with the service we offer”

In 2023, Azores Airlines and SATA Air Açores combined were responsible for transporting 2.4 million passengers, representing an increase compared to 2022. Azores Airlines, connecting the archipelago to abroad, recorded a notable growth of 33% in compared to the previous year and a surprising 52% compared to 2019, before the pandemic.

Azores Airlines stands out as the main airline offering vital connections to the Azores, connecting the archipelago to North America, Europe (including mainland Portugal), Madeira and Cape Verde. This year, the company will expand its routes, including destinations such as Milan and London, in addition to strengthening domestic connections, increasing travel options between Europe and North America.

SATA Group carriers play a fundamental role in the development of tourism in the Azores, ensuring essential connectivity to explore the different islands in an organized and comfortable way.
